About the Item

Wonderful design by Milan Grygar features on the 70s re-release Czech film poster for Charles Chaplin classic, The Gold Rush. Like their neighbours in Poland, the designers of the Czech Republic, free from commercial constraints and enjoying far greater artistic freedom than their Western counterparts, treated film poster design as an art form. The result is an immensely powerful, wildly original and beautiful body of work. This original vintage movie poster is sized 22 7/8 x 32 inches. It will be sent rolled (unframed). Year 1973 re-release Poster Type CZE A1 Style - Art by Milan Grygar Rolled/Folded/Other Folded/Rolled Condition Excellent.
